Food scene
Shooters Waterfront restaurant is on the beautiful Fort Lauderdale Intercoastal at Oakland Park Blvd., and accessible by Ft Lauderdale Water Taxi stop. Shooters’ brunch features a massive buffet (think waffles and crepes, smoked salmon, sushi and more), plus a menu that ranges from lobster Benedict to steak and eggs to homemade cinnamon rolls. And $20 gets you two hours of the bottomless mimosas or bloody marys. And all of that gets served up in Shooters’ unparalleled location. When the weather’s good, the place’s massive Intracoastal-facing outdoor area remains one of the best spots in Fort Lauderdale for people and boat watching. If you’ve got a lazy Sunday, this is the place to spend it.

Things to do
he NSU Art Museum Fort Lauderdale is an art museum in Fort Lauderdale, Florida. Originating in 1958 as the Fort Lauderdale Art Center, the museum is located in a 75,000-square-foot modernist building designed by Edward Larrabee Barnes.
